Spanish III for International Business
In this course students continue to develop for career purposes a balanced, flexible, four-skills approach to Spanish that stresses communicative competency and cross-cultural awareness of retail businesses, national and regional specialties, geographic food-name variants, household setting and chores, personal care and routines, as well as the mastery of language structures. Communicative exercises and scenarios involve students in personalized responses and pair work which reflect general and potential business situations in the future career of students.
